Output e26bf60c613218ea3f9b32205aa86e41a2ae91a8b92be57c02cfaf84968fcb0b:0
- value
- 1992489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a82bf42e44203c92366497e9822b0af0b68adca6 OP_EQUAL
- address
- MPENQd7R8G7R6nzshHLgyJmkoCEKKPTSL7
- transaction
- e26bf60c613218ea3f9b32205aa86e41a2ae91a8b92be57c02cfaf84968fcb0b
- spent
- true